Why Is Dacryocystitis Becoming a Growing Concern in Ophthalmology?
Dacryocystitis, an infection or inflammation of the lacrimal sac, is becoming an increasing concern in ophthalmology due to its potential complications, including abscess formation and vision impairment. The condition is often caused by bacterial infections, trauma, or obstructions in the tear drainage system, leading to painful swelling, excessive tearing, and pus discharge. If left untreated, dacryocystitis can progress to orbital cellulitis or systemic infections, making early diagnosis and treatment essential.The rising prevalence of age-related eye disorders, congenital tear duct obstructions in newborns, and post-surgical complications has increased the incidence of dacryocystitis. Additionally, the growing number of contact lens users and individuals undergoing aesthetic eyelid surgeries has contributed to a higher risk of tear duct infections. Advancements in minimally invasive surgical techniques and antibiotic therapies are improving patient outcomes, driving demand for effective treatment solutions.
What Are the Latest Innovations in Dacryocystitis Treatment?
The treatment of dacryocystitis has evolved with the introduction of advanced antibiotic therapies, minimally invasive procedures, and novel drug delivery systems. One of the most significant advancements is endoscopic dacryocystorhinostomy (DCR), a minimally invasive surgical procedure that creates a new tear drainage pathway without external incisions. This technique has become the preferred treatment for chronic dacryocystitis, reducing scarring and recovery time.Additionally, the use of biodegradable drug-eluting stents is improving post-surgical outcomes by preventing tear duct re-blockage and reducing infection risks. Nanoparticle-based antibiotic eye drops are also being developed to enhance drug penetration and prolong antibacterial activity. AI-driven diagnostic tools and imaging techniques, such as dacryoscintigraphy and ultrasonography, are aiding in the early detection and personalized treatment of dacryocystitis.
